DyFlex Develops New Cloud ERP Software for Renewables Sector

cloud-ERP-software.png

SAP Gold Partner DyFlex Solutions developed the new cloud ERP software to support the surging renewable energy market as well as provide job opportunities to Australians.

The Australian Energy Statistics, the authoritative and official source of energy statistics for Australia, has revealed remarkable achievements in the country’s energy consumption, particularly in the use of renewable sources. The report stated that Australia’s economic growth over the recent decades demonstrated improvements in energy efficiencies and productivity with the use of renewables, for instance, instead of fossil fuels for electricity generation. The updated 2020 report stated that the country’s renewable generation grew in 2019, achieving a 21 per cent share of total electricity generation with Solar PV driving growth– a respectable accomplishment since the completion of the Snowy Mountains hydroelectric scheme in the mid-1970s.

Acknowledging the country’s marked increase in renewable energy generation, Perth-based DyFlex Solutions has developed DyFlex Green Energy Solutions, software specifically designed for businesses in the renewable energy industry. As a fully-integrated platform, the new solution is designed to help organisations manage a range of business operations including human resources, inventory, finances, supply chain, logistics, and reporting. 

Bespoke Cloud ERP Software

SAP Business ByDesign, a cloud-based ERP solution that connects every function across an organisation to time-tested best practices and in-depth analytics, powers DyFlex Green Energy Solutions. It provides fast-growing, mid-market businesses the foundation to scale and compete without the complexity and cost. Now, the latest ERP solution from DyFlex tailor-made for the renewables sector not only backs businesses in the renewable energy sector and Australia’s position in the clean energy revolution but also offers job opportunities for the locals.

Sharing the rationale behind developing the latest DyFlex Green Energy Solutions, DyFlex Managing Director Peter Lander said:

“The future of energy is clean and Australia has the opportunity to lead the world – all while delivering a sustainable economic boom and creating local jobs. This is why we have developed software specifically designed to support businesses within the renewables industry. We are doing our part to drive a fast-growing industry that will deliver jobs and strong economic growth for Australia.”

“Unlike other industry transitions such as automotive manufacturing and steel smelting, which saw many jobs move offshore, the transition to renewable energy can actually create jobs in Australia”, he added.

According to the University of Technology Sydney’s Institute for Sustainable Futures, the renewable energy industry is forecasted to create 20,000 new jobs over the next five years.

DyFlex and SAP Driving Sustainability

A long-term key supplier to Australia’s natural resources sector, DyFlex Solutions’ new platform coupled with the company’s expertise in the renewables industry will further help businesses modernise business processes and tackle new challenges. Along the same lines, DyFlex’s software ERP partner SAP also supports enterprises in the renewable energy industry with sustainable, intelligent solutions. 

SAP enabled AGL Energy’s modernisation project with cloud-based solutions SAP S/4HANA, SAP SuccessFactors, and SAP Ariba. SDE Mexico, an importer and distributor of solar panels, tapped the German software giant and deployed SAP Business One solution to streamline operations across its four headquarters, enabling the company to take advantage of the booming renewables market.
